Output 57c89ffd5340bd0234a99a73853e71eaae1beade6f08aa966520a19325d6438d:1

value
249296670
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e5f175e481fe2435c2065bd8ae906dfaaf543760 OP_EQUAL
address
3NeqvShJMyPzL9Npz7E1A4xDNyETDBRhwR
transaction
57c89ffd5340bd0234a99a73853e71eaae1beade6f08aa966520a19325d6438d
spent
true